CME FedWatch data, cited by Jin10 and carried by ChainCatcher, shows markets pricing a 69.5% probability that the U.S. Federal Reserve will leave rates unchanged in July. The probability of a cumulative 25-basis-point rate hike by that meeting stands at 30.5%. Looking ahead to September, the probability of no change falls to 23.4%. At the same time, the probability of a cumulative 25-basis-point increase rises to 56.4%, while the probability of a cumulative 50-basis-point increase is 20.2%. The figures reflect current rate expectations shown by CME FedWatch.
